Join the BSAC Poseidon SE7EN try-dive event
Places available on 26 and 27 March for club members who want to try a rebreather
The British Sub-Aqua Club (BSAC) is holding a Poseidon SE7EN rebreather try-dive event at Stoney Cove on the weekend of 26th and 27th March 2022.
The Club is looking for members who are keen to experience closed circuit rebreather (CCR) diving for themselves – and maybe consider moving into technical diving through the BSAC range of programmes.
The event is open to Sports Divers and above, and costs from £10.
